Athene brama
Small owl. Grey wings with spots. Front is white.
In the residential colony where I stayed...there were areas left to run wild and the colony had lots of trees. This one and its friends were resting on the branches of a tree in a quadrangle outside the houses. At least three owlets flew away...this one did not...Almost got attacked by the resident pariah dogs that objected to me stalking their trees.
This owl is named brama in homage to the Hindu God of all creation; Brahma.
